黑狐家游戏

阿里云服务器连接本地数据库,阿里云连接数据库教程

欧气 1 0

本文目录导读:

  1. 准备工作
  2. 在阿里云服务器上安装数据库客户端
  3. 建立连接
  4. 可能遇到的问题及解决方法

阿里云服务器连接本地数据库全解析

准备工作

1、阿里云服务器相关信息

- 确保你已经拥有一台阿里云服务器,并且知道服务器的公网IP地址、用户名和密码,这些信息在购买服务器后可以在阿里云控制台获取。

- 检查服务器的安全组规则,安全组类似于一个虚拟的防火墙,需要确保允许与本地数据库进行连接的端口(如MySQL默认的3306端口)的入站和出站规则,如果没有设置正确的规则,连接将会被拒绝。

阿里云服务器连接本地数据库,阿里云连接数据库教程

图片来源于网络,如有侵权联系删除

2、本地数据库相关信息

- 确定本地数据库的类型,这里以常见的MySQL数据库为例,了解本地MySQL数据库的版本号、是否开启远程连接功能、用户名和密码等重要信息。

- 如果本地数据库没有开启远程连接功能,需要进行相应的配置,对于MySQL数据库,可以编辑配置文件(如my.cnf或my.ini),找到bind - address选项,将其值从127.0.0.1修改为0.0.0.0,然后重启MySQL服务,不过要注意,这样做会增加一定的安全风险,需要确保服务器处于安全的网络环境中。

在阿里云服务器上安装数据库客户端

1、安装MySQL客户端(以CentOS系统为例)

- 登录到阿里云服务器,使用以下命令更新系统软件包:

```bash

yum update -y

```

- 安装MySQL客户端:

```bash

yum install mysql - y

```

- 安装完成后,可以使用mysql - V命令来验证MySQL客户端是否安装成功。

2、安装其他数据库客户端(如PostgreSQL等)

- 如果要连接的是PostgreSQL数据库,对于CentOS系统,可以使用以下命令安装客户端:

- 首先添加PostgreSQL的yum仓库:

```bash

阿里云服务器连接本地数据库,阿里云连接数据库教程

图片来源于网络,如有侵权联系删除

yum install -y https://download.postgresql.org/pub/repos/yum/reporpms/EL - 7 - x86_64/pgdg - redhat - repo - latest.noarch.rpm

```

- 然后安装PostgreSQL客户端:

```bash

yum install -y postgresql - client

```

建立连接

1、连接MySQL数据库

- 使用以下命令连接本地MySQL数据库:

```bash

mysql -h [本地数据库IP地址] -P [端口号] -u [用户名] -p

```

如果本地数据库IP地址为192.168.1.100,端口为3306,用户名为root,则命令为:

```bash

mysql -h 192.168.1.100 -P 3306 -u root -p

```

输入密码后,如果连接成功,将会进入MySQL的命令行界面,可以进行数据库的操作,如查询数据库列表(show databases;)等操作。

2、连接PostgreSQL数据库

阿里云服务器连接本地数据库,阿里云连接数据库教程

图片来源于网络,如有侵权联系删除

- 使用以下命令连接本地PostgreSQL数据库:

```bash

psql -h [本地数据库IP地址] -p [端口号] -U [用户名] -W

```

如果本地数据库IP地址为192.168.1.100,端口为5432,用户名为postgres,则命令为:

```bash

psql -h 192.168.1.100 -p 5432 -U postgres -W

```

这里的-W选项表示在连接时会提示输入密码,输入正确密码后即可连接到数据库并进行操作。

可能遇到的问题及解决方法

1、连接被拒绝

- 如果遇到连接被拒绝的情况,首先检查安全组规则,对于阿里云服务器,确认是否允许相应端口的入站和出站流量。

- 检查本地数据库的远程连接配置是否正确,如MySQL的bind - address设置以及是否有防火墙阻止了连接等。

2、身份验证失败

- 仔细检查连接命令中的用户名和密码是否正确,对于MySQL数据库,如果使用了特殊的身份验证插件,可能需要进行额外的配置,如果使用了caching_sha2_password插件,在较旧版本的MySQL客户端连接时可能会出现问题,可以将插件更改为mysql_native_password或者升级MySQL客户端版本。

通过以上步骤,就可以在阿里云服务器上成功连接本地数据库,方便进行数据管理、备份、迁移等操作,在整个过程中,要特别注意安全问题,尤其是在开放本地数据库的远程连接功能时,要采取相应的安全措施,如设置强密码、限制IP访问等。

标签: #阿里云 #服务器 #本地数据库

黑狐家游戏
  • 评论列表

留言评论